Output 4bf39f51fedebe96b4e69221305ec6dc03bd088cde9a9c94d79d38b0697d3a65:0

value
1082607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5396655bf52833afa8e3ad225e11b592ac4c4130 OP_EQUAL
address
39JzBA96pPxMcdHARXdy7pE2YJUsA3B3zR
transaction
4bf39f51fedebe96b4e69221305ec6dc03bd088cde9a9c94d79d38b0697d3a65
confirmations
137565
spent
true